Runbook 4.2 — Tour Props Dispatch

Props for the Windmere Players tour ship from Bay 3 only. Each crate must carry a stamped manifest and a green tour tag. Fragile items (masks, lanterns) ride top-loaded. Carrier is Drayhart Freight; their driver signs the release sheet before loading begins. Once signatures are done, the dispatcher gives the driver this hand-over instruction.

dispatch memo: the lamwyn fenwyn courier leaves the wenir ledger at gate 7175 under passcode 822969

Q3 Planning Note — Supplier Contract Renewal

The Varnholt Components agreement expires end of Q3. Renewal terms offered: 4% price increase, three-year lock-in, improved delivery SLAs. Alternative bids from Keldrow Fabrication came in 7% higher. Procurement recommends renewal with a two-year cap. Decision required at the October board session. Context on our wider sourcing strategy follows below.

board note of bawep-tajef: Queniusek Systems plans to raise the Quenvan list price by 53.1 percent in March. The pricing group signed off on a budget of $176.4 million for Project Drueth. The renewal with Casionix Partners closes at $142.5 million a year, 8.3 percent below the last contract. Project Fraax slips by six weeks because of the tooling delay.

Vendor note: Driver assignment on the Quellford routes uses a nearest-idle heuristic with a 12-minute staleness cap. If a driver's ping is older than that, Dispatchly drops them from the pool automatically, so don't reassign manually. Fleet partners like Harvane Couriers sometimes flag this as missing drivers; it isn't. For assignment disputes, reach the vendor desk here.

billing contact of tahaf-kafop = istwyn_fraox@norvaworks.corp

**Vendor note: Inkmill markdown pipeline**

Rendering for Parchway docs is outsourced to Inkmill under an annual contract, renewing each March. They handle sanitization and PDF export; we own the upload queue. SLA: 4-hour response on rendering failures. Escalate only after two failed retries. Their support desk is reachable at the address below.

billing contact of hahaf-baguf = zorael.tammir.jorius@sivrelhq.internal